Bikrampur
Bikrampur is a village located in Surajgarha subdivision of Lakhisarai district in Bihar, India. It is situated 4km away from sub-district headquarter Surajgarha (tehsildar office) and 16km away from district headquarter Lakhisarai. As per 2009 stats, Mohammadpur is the gram panchayat of Bikrampur village.

About Bikrampur
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Bikrampur is 243399. The village spans a total geographical area of 77 hectares. Lakhisarai is nearest town to Bikrampur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 16km away.

Population of Bikrampur
According to the 2011 Census, Bikrampur has a total population of about 3,481, with approximately 1,858 males and 1,623 females. The sex ratio is around 873 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 698 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 201 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 39.30%, with male literacy at about 47.52% and female literacy near 29.88%. There are around 522 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 3,481 | 1,858 | 1,623 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 698 | 356 | 342 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 201 | 101 | 100 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 1,368 | 883 | 485 |
Illiterate Population | 2,113 | 975 | 1,138 |
Connectivity of Bikrampur
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Bikrampur. As per the 2011 stats, Bikrampur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
